BODY {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size: 11pt;color : #000000;}
H3 {font-family: Verdana, Arial, Helvetica, sans-serif;  font-size: 16pt; font-weight: normal;
	line-height: 14pt; margin-top: 5px;  margin-bottom: 7px; }
A {font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;color : #003399;}
A.white {font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;color : #ffffff;}
A:Visited {font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;color : #003399;}
A:Active {color : #330099;}
A:Hover {color : #000000;}
.confirm {font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; font-size : 13pt; font-weight:bold; letter-spacing : 1px;}
TEXTAREA {font-family : 'MS Sans Serif';font-size : 10pt;}
TD {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;vertical-align : top;}
.help {font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;font-size : 10pt;font-weight : normal;color : #990000;}
.helpMed {font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;font-size : 12pt;font-weight : normal;color : #990000;}
.errorMsg {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 10pt;font-weight : bold;color : #FF0000;background-color : #FFFFFF;}
.medium {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 10pt;font-weight : normal;color : #000000;}
li.arrow {list-style-image : url(/bench/images/arrow.gif);list-style-position : inside;line-height : 12pt;}
HR.lineTbl {color : #003399;height : 1;}

.labelBB {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;font-weight : bold;color : #000000;background-color : #e9EED8; text-align: right;  vertical-align:middle; white-space : nowrap; border-bottom-color : Gray;border-bottom-style : solid;border-bottom : 1px solid Gray;}
.outputBB {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;background-color : #e9EED8;border-bottom-color : Gray;border-bottom-style : solid;border-bottom : 1px solid Gray;}

.Even {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;background-color : #e9EED8;border-bottom-color : Gray;border-bottom-style : solid;border-bottom : 1px solid Gray;}
.Odd {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;background-color : #ffffff; border-bottom : 1px solid Gray;}
TR.Even {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;background-color : #e9EED8;}
TR.Odd {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;background-color : #ffffff;}
input.blueButton {font-weight : normal;color : #000000;}
TD.tableLabel {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;font-weight : bold;color : #000000;background-color : #cccc99;text-align: right;vertical-align : middle;white-space : nowrap;}
TD.tableLabel-tv {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;font-weight : bold;color : #000000;background-color : #cccc99;text-align: right;vertical-align : top;white-space : nowrap;}
TD.tableInput {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 8pt;font-weight : bold;color : #003399;background-color : #cccc99;vertical-align: middle;}
TD.tdOutput {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;background-color : #e9EED8;vertical-align: middle;}
TD.tableHd2 {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 10pt;font-weight : bold;color : #000000;background-color : #ffffff;text-align: right;}
TD.tableHeader {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 9pt;font-weight : bold;color : #000000;background-color : #cccc99;text-align: left;vertical-align: bottom;}
TD.tableColumn {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 10pt;font-weight : bold;color : #ffffff;background-color : #003399;}
.tableTitle10 {font-family : Arial,Helvetica,Geneva,Sans Serif;font-size : 10pt;font-weight : bold;color : #ffffff;background-color : #a96b60;letter-spacing: 1;}
.folder{text-decoration: none;	color: black;font: 9pt 'Lucida Grande', Geneva, Arial, Verdana, sans-serif;}
.folderS{ text-decoration: none; color: white; background-color:silver;}
A.folder:Hove{text-decoration: underline;color: #FF6100;}

.large {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 13;
	font-weight : bold;
	color : #003399;
}

.font13 {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 13;
	font-weight : bold;
	color : #003399;
}

.font10 {
	font-family :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 10;
	font-weight : bold;
	color : #003399;
}
table.printClass{border: 1px solid Black; border-top: 2px solid Black; color: Black;}
td.printClass{border-bottom: 1px solid Gray; border-right: 1px solid Gray;}
td.printHeader{border-bottom: 1px solid Gray; border-right: 1px solid Gray;font-weight:bold;font-size:9pt;}
td.printHDEnd{border-bottom: 1px solid Gray;font-weight:bold;font-size:9pt;}
td.printEnd{border-bottom: 1px solid Gray;}